Photovoltaic (PV) panels generate electricity from sunlight, but without batteries, that energy can't be stored for later use. The batteries paired with solar panels are commonly called solar energy storage systems or photovoltaic batteries.

Solar technologies convert sunlight into electrical energy either through photovoltaic (PV) panels or through mirrors that concentrate solar radiation.
